Didn't need to reopen the session this time at least. > > Thank you for solving this issue for me! :) > > John André > > *** > John André Netland - Voice/SMS/MMS (+47) 971 68 794 > Visit online at www.a-pro-studio.no > *** > > On 30. sep. 2012, at 01:57, Slau Halatyn wrote: > >> OK, I've tried a few things and it's hard to pinpoint exactly what's going >> on because it's a combination of ghost images and screen redraws. Whatever >> the case, occasionally, closing the Edit window and reopening it resets the >> way VoiceOver sees the playlist selector when changing from mini view to >> medium to jumbo, etc. Long story short, in anything below medium, the >> playlist selector, whether it's seen or not, is not active and if you change >> track heights to make it reappear, you might have to reopen the session to >> have it reappear and be active. The point is, the sure-fire way to get the >> playlist selector back and active is to use the Control-up arrow command on >> selected tracks, save and reopen the session. >> >> HTH, >> >> Slau >> >> On Sep 29, 2012, at 3:53 AM, Scott Chesworth wrote: >> >>> Dare say you'll get to this one first dude, I'm not in front of PT >>> again for the next week or so.
